Hello Karmalita,

Blessings to you! Yes, food has the ability to uplift, when we choose what is good for ourselves. I could tell you what is good for me, but, sweet one, we are all different. It would be like a wolf telling a duck what to eat. What I do suggest is to keep a food journal for 2 months. I know you are tired, so keep it simple. Most of us have something we keep with us at all times. Purse, cell phone, hair brush, etc. Keep a tiny book and pen/pencil with that item. At most dollar stores you can find this set up. Jot down what you eat and the time, if you ate because of hunger or craving, and if you had something to drink with it....whatever info you have the time and effort to record. If you notice that you crash down after eating something or drinking something, or feel emotionally different, make a BOLD mark and write down the affect. Being vegetarian is good, and even better when most of what you eat is fresh, raw and organic. Many advise against meat based protein which also tends to be high fat, and even when organic, as environmental toxins increase up the food chain.

Avoid processed carbs and sugar as they make your insulin and blood sugar levels go crazy (therefore your mood). I've not gone Atkins, but a low carb diet where those carbs are complex makes me feel a lot better.

Eat plenty of fibre and drink enough water.

You could research some supplements and specific superfoods e.g. aloe, glucosamine, shitake mushrooms, spiulina, a good plant based multivitamin (aborbed better than chemicals or ground rock), omega 3 (organic flax is a good veggie source).

May also be worth an allergy screening just in case - lactose, yeast and gluten being fairly common.

For avoidance - cigarettes, too much alcohol, sugar, meat (especially cheap non-organic), caffeine.
